Say Cheese! 15 Tips to Improve Your Photos

You don't always need a fancy camera or training in photography to take great pictures; find out how you can take pro-level photos. By Joy Jesena-Barcelon
4 Comments
Add Yours

Most of us have cameras. Whether it's a point-and-shoot, digital single lens reflex (DSLR), cellphone, or tablet, we've often used this gadget to capture a beautiful image, only to be disappointed with the results. We often delete right away without even analyzing how we can improve the quality of the photos we take.

The slide show below contains tips on taking better photos or making them better by using photo editing software. And don't think you need a sophisticated program--even the most basic and user-friendly editing software is quite capable of letting you come up with more professional-looking images.

Click through the slides to learn how you can make your photographs look better without a lot of effort.
